Senate Democratic Leadership Outline Hopes for Budget Ahead of Governor’s Address

CONCORD - Today, Senate Democratic Leader Donna Soucy (D-Manchester) and Deputy Senate Democratic Leader Cindy Rosenwald (D-Nashua) discussed what they hoped to see in the budget ahead of Governor Sununu’s budget address.


Senate Democratic Leader Donna Soucy (D-Manchester) and Deputy Senate Democratic Leader Cindy Rosenwald (D-Nashua) issued the following statement:


“The state budget is the most significant reflection of state leaders’ priorities for the people of New Hampshire. Today, Governor Sununu has the opportunity to set us on a path for relief and recovery from the most important and immediate issue facing our state, which is the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ic,” stated Senate Democratic Leader Donna Soucy (D-Manchester). “This plan should include a robust investment to shore up the relief and recovery efforts of our cities and towns, as well as ensuring access to mental health services and treatment for those in need of support.”


“It is critical that any budget proposal issued by the Governor maintains the historic investment made in public education by the last budget to ensure every child in New Hampshire has access to a comprehensive and adequate education, regardless of their zip code,” stated Deputy Senate Democratic Leader Cindy Rosenwald (D-Nashua). “It is also imperative that his proposal provides much-needed property tax relief to taxpayers. The last thing New Hampshire families need is to be stuck paying the bill for downshifted costs from the state.”
